Consent banner rollout on Pellwick drifted between regions. Kestrel cluster shows the new banner config; Marrow cluster still serves the old opt-out flow. Support is seeing tickets from users getting inconsistent prompts. Root cause: a hotfix last week was applied manually to Kestrel only and never committed. Do not hand-edit further. Treat the values below as canonical until the config repo is reconciled and redeployed. The correct live configuration for both clusters is as follows.

service settings:
PRAWYN_PIN=9848
PRAWYN_METRICS_HOST=metrics.prawyn.lumicworks.corp
PRAWYN_LOG_LEVEL=warn
PRAWYN_TENANT=pelius

Handover note — Crumbwheel order cutoffs.

Welcome aboard. The bakery cutoff rule in Crumbwheel closes same-day orders at 14:00 local to each storefront, not UTC — this has bitten us twice. Holiday overrides live in the calendar service and take precedence silently, so always check there first when a cutoff looks wrong. To unlock the calendar service's admin console after a restart, enter the recovery passphrase below.

vault phrase of bagap-bahaf = silion-pelox-sorox-casdor-quenwyn-fraax-eliox-praael-kelion-quenvan-kasox-rusael-norius-belvan

## Idempotency Keys for Payment Retries (Lumopay)

Every retry of a charge request must reuse the original idempotency key; generating a new key on retry can produce duplicate charges. Keys are scoped per merchant and expire after 48 hours. Reviewers should verify keys are derived server-side, never from client input. The full key-generation specification and threat model are maintained on the internal page.

dashboard of kaguf-tawip = https://vault.merlaqsys.test/issue

## Configuration

Welcome aboard! You're here to help squash the session-token refresh bug in Wrenbolt. Short version: the Kestral auth layer refreshes tokens 30 seconds *after* expiry instead of before, so users on the Marlow dashboard get randomly logged out mid-form. To reproduce locally you'll need the dev env file with `TOKEN_REFRESH_SKEW=-30` to simulate the bad behavior, plus the auth stub pointed at the sandbox. The sandbox requires its own credential, so add that credential on the line right below.

env line for fafof-fahag: LEDGER_TOKEN5=f8790